
Exciting Developments in AI: OpenAI's Stargate Initiative
Recent developments in the world of artificial intelligence (AI) have sent shockwaves through the tech industry, with South Korean tech giants Samsung Electronics and SK Hynix seeing their stocks soar post-announcement of a collaboration with OpenAI for the ambitious $500 billion Stargate initiative. This collaboration aims to fortify AI data center infrastructure, especially in South Korea, which is touted to become a global hub for advanced AI technologies.
Market Reactions: A Surge in Stocks
The partnership with OpenAI has propelled the stock prices of SK Hynix and Samsung Electronics to unprecedented heights, with SK Hynix's shares climbing nearly 10% and Samsung’s up approximately 3.5%. This bullish reaction underscores investor confidence in the future potential of AI technologies and the strategic importance of South Korea in this rapidly evolving sector.
What Is the Stargate Project and Its Implications?
The Stargate project is positioned as a monumental step towards enhancing the AI data center framework that OpenAI envisions for its operations. As per projections by OpenAI, the demand for DRAM (Dynamic Random-Access Memory) wafers is expected to more than double the current HBM (High Bandwidth Memory) industry capacity, revealing a significant potential for growth in the semiconductor market driven by AI advancements.

Strategic Alliances to Meet Surging Demand
Fortifying this initiative, SK Hynix is expected to supply up to 900,000 DRAM wafers monthly to meet the needs of OpenAI. This commitment signifies a collaborative effort to address the escalating demand for advanced memory solutions critical to AI processing capabilities. Innovative Directions: Floating Data Centers and Beyond
What draws attention is the exploration of floating data centers — an innovative approach to tackling cooling costs and land scarcity. Samsung and SK are looking not just to lead in traditional data center solutions, but also to venture into this uncharted territory, demonstrating forward-thinking strategies that can reshape the infrastructure landscape.
